Editor's Note: The 2026 FIFA World Cup will be the first to feature 48 teams, expanding the tournament significantly. This expansion is also reflected in the multi-nation hosting. The mascot's design is likely intended to mirror this larger, more diverse, and digitally integrated event. Fans used to mascots like Striker from USA '94 might find this a significant departure.
